Assessing Your Current Bike
Before embarking on an upgrade, it’s crucial to evaluate your existing dirt jump bike thoroughly. Consider factors such as the frame’s material, geometry, and overall condition. The material of the frame plays a significant role in its performance. Common materials include aluminum, steel, and carbon fiber. Aluminum frames are lightweight, corrosion – resistant, and relatively affordable, making them a popular choice for many riders. Steel frames, on the other hand, offer superior strength and durability, providing a smooth ride but are generally heavier. Carbon fiber frames are the lightest and most expensive option, offering excellent stiffness and vibration damping properties.
The geometry of the frame is another critical aspect. Dirt jump bikes typically have a shorter wheelbase and a steeper head tube angle compared to other types of mountain bikes. This geometry provides better maneuverability and responsiveness, which are essential for performing jumps and tricks. Measure your current frame’s key dimensions, such as the top tube length, seat tube angle, and chainstay length, to ensure compatibility with the new frame.
Inspect your existing frame for signs of wear and damage, such as cracks, dents, or rust. If the frame is severely damaged, it’s best to replace it rather than attempt to repair it. However, if the damage is minor, you may be able to fix it before upgrading.

Selecting the Right Frame
When selecting a new dirt jump bike frame, there are several factors to consider. First and foremost, ensure that the frame is compatible with your existing components. Check the frame’s specifications for details such as the bottom bracket type, head tube size, and dropout spacing. These should match the components on your current bike or the ones you plan to use.
Consider the frame’s size as well. The right frame size is crucial for a comfortable and efficient riding experience. Too small a frame can make you feel cramped and limit your movement, while too large a frame can make the bike difficult to handle. Use a sizing chart provided by the manufacturer to determine the appropriate frame size based on your height and inseam measurement.
Read reviews and do some research on different frame brands and models. Look for feedback from other riders who have used the frames you’re considering. Pay attention to factors such as the frame’s strength, weight, and overall quality. Preparing for the Upgrade
Before you start the upgrade process, gather all the necessary tools and equipment. You’ll need basic bike tools such as wrenches, hex keys, and a headset press. Make sure your workspace is clean and well – organized to avoid losing any small parts during the disassembly process.
Take your time to carefully disassemble your current bike. Start by removing the wheels, seat, handlebars, and pedals. Then, separate the drivetrain components, such as the chain, derailleurs, and crankset. Label each part and keep them organized in a safe place.
If you’re reusing your existing headset, remove it from the old frame using a headset press. Make sure to follow the manufacturer’s instructions carefully to avoid damaging the headset.
Installing the New Frame
Once you’ve prepared your components and cleaning the new frame, it’s time to start the installation process. Begin by installing the headset into the new frame. Apply a small amount of grease to the headset bearings and carefully press them into the frame using the headset press.
Next, install the bottom bracket into the frame. Again, apply a thin layer of grease to the bottom bracket cups or bearings before fitting them into the frame. Use the appropriate tools to tighten the bottom bracket to the manufacturer’s recommended torque settings.
Install the fork into the headset. Make sure the fork is properly aligned and that the steerer tube extends through the top of the headset. Secure the fork using the headset spacers and stem.
Attach the drivetrain components to the new frame. Install the chain, derailleurs, and crankset, ensuring that they are properly adjusted and aligned. Check the chain tension and make any necessary adjustments.
Reattach the wheels, seat, handlebars, and pedals to the bike. Make sure all the components are tightened to the appropriate torque settings to ensure safe and reliable operation.
Testing and Fine – Tuning
After installing the new frame, it’s important to test the bike thoroughly to ensure everything is working correctly. Take the bike for a short test ride in a safe area, paying attention to how it handles and performs. Check for any unusual noises, vibrations, or handling issues.
If you notice any problems during the test ride, make the necessary adjustments. You may need to fine – tune the brakes, gears, or suspension to optimize the bike’s performance. It’s also a good idea to have your bike professionally tuned and inspected after the upgrade to ensure that everything is in proper working order.
